Comprehending Transponder Technology
The word "transponder" is a portmanteau of "transmitter" and "responder." Inside the plastic head of a contemporary car key sits a small microchip. This chip does not normally require a battery to send its identification code; instead, it is powered by an electro-magnetic field created by the induction coil surrounding the ignition cylinder.
When a motorist inserts the key and turns it to the "on" position, the lorry's Engine Control Unit (ECU) sends a burst of energy to the key. The transponder chip absorbs this energy and relays a special alphanumeric code back to the ECU. If the code matches the one kept in the vehicle's memory, the immobilizer system is disarmed, and the engine begins. If the codes do not match, or if no signal is identified, the fuel pump and ignition system remain disabled, preventing the car from being hot-wired.
Typical Signs That a Transponder Key Needs Repair
Identifying a failing transponder key early can avoid an overall lockout circumstance. Due to the fact that the system involves both electronic and physical elements, signs can vary.
- Failure to Start: The engine cranks but will not fire, or the car stays totally silent when the key is turned.
- Security Light Activation: A dashboard caution light (typically formed like a key or a car with a padlock) remains lit up or flashes quickly.
- Intermittent Functionality: The key works on some attempts however fails on others, suggesting a loose connection or a degrading chip.
- Physical Damage: The plastic casing is broken, or the key has actually been exposed to extreme heat or moisture, which can desolder internal elements.
- Distance Issues: For "push-to-start" cars, the car may stop working to detect the key even when it is inside the cabin.

One Of The Most Common Transponder Repairs
While some problems require an overall replacement, many transponder issues are fixable by a proficient professional or a specialized locksmith professional.
1. Shell and Button Replacement
Typically, the internal transponder chip is completely practical, but the external plastic casing has actually broken down or the rubber buttons have actually used away. Fixing this includes transferring the initial circuit board and transponder chip into a brand-new, high-quality "shell." This is the most affordable repair technique.
2. Micro-Switch Resoldering
On keys with incorporated remote entry, the physical buttons (micro-switches) on the circuit board can become detached due to repetitive pressure. A service technician can use precision soldering tools to re-attach these switches, bring back the key's ability to lock and unlock the doors.
3. Battery Replacement (For Remote/Fob Keys)
While the transponder chip itself is frequently passive (battery-less), the remote entry functions and "smart key" proximity signals require a source of power. Changing a diminished CR2032 or similar coin-cell battery frequently restores performance to keys that the car no longer "sees."
4. Transponder Reprogramming
In some cases the hardware is great, however the software application data has actually become damaged due to electromagnetic interference or an automobile battery rise. In this case, a locksmith professional uses an OBD-II diagnostic tool to "re-sync" the key to the car's ECU.
The Professional Repair Process
Repairing a transponder key is a technical process that requires customized equipment. Unlike conventional secrets, which can be cut at a hardware store, transponder repair work typically include the following actions:
- Diagnostic Testing: The service technician utilizes a transponder reader (frequency tester) to see if the chip is producing a signal. If the chip is "dead," a repair is impossible, and a replacement is necessary.
- Disassembly: The key fob is thoroughly opened utilizing non-marring tools to avoid damaging the fragile internal circuit board.
- Part Inspection: Using magnification, the service technician looks for "cold" solder joints, wetness corrosion, or cracked elements.
- Cleansing: The circuit board is cleaned up with isopropyl alcohol to eliminate oil, dirt, and oxidation that might be disrupting the signal.
- Re-Programming: If the repair involves a brand-new chip, the service technician connects a programming device to the lorry's computer port to present the brand-new chip's ID code to the system.

DIY vs. Professional Locksmith Services
In an era of YouTube tutorials, many motorists are lured to repair their own transponder keys. While changing a battery or a plastic shell is a feasible DIY project, more intricate repair work carry dangers.
- The Risk of "Bricking": Attempting to configure a key utilizing cheap, unverified software from the web can sometimes lock the lorry's ECU, needing a costly tow to a dealer and a complete system reset.
- Precision Soldering: The components on a key circuit board are tiny. Without a steady hand and a fine-tip soldering iron, it is easy to bridge 2 connections and brief out the whole chip.
- Equipment Costs: Professional transponder programming tools typically cost countless dollars. The tools offered to customers for ₤ 20 are frequently undependable and lack the security bypass procedures for modern-day automobiles.
Avoidance and Maintenance Tips
To prevent the requirement for emergency transponder repair, vehicle owners must follow these upkeep guidelines:
- Avoid Moisture: Never immerse a key fob. If it gets damp, eliminate the battery immediately and dry it with silica gel packets.
- Separate the Keychain: Excessive weight on the ignition cylinder can harm the induction coil that reads the transponder chip.
- Keep a Spare: Always have at least one working extra. If the main key fails, an extra allows the driver to reach a repair center without a tow truck.
- Use High-Quality Batteries: When changing fob batteries, utilize reputable brands to avoid leakages that can corrode the transponder circuitry.
Often Asked Questions (FAQ)
1. Can a transponder key be fixed if it was dropped in water?
Yes, if the key is dealt with immediately. The battery must be removed, and the internal board must be cleaned up with electronic cleaner to avoid corrosion. However, if the water triggered a short circuit while the battery was active, the chip might be completely damaged.
2. Why does the dealer charge a lot more than a locksmith?
Dealerships have high overhead costs and usually choose full replacement rather than individual component repair. Locksmiths specialize in "repair," which permits them to offer lower rates by repairing just the damaged parts.

4. Can I buy a transponder chip online and program it myself?
For some older automobiles (early 2000s Ford, Toyota, or GM), "on-board programs" allows users to set a new key if they have 2 existing working secrets. For more recent cars, a specialized diagnostic tool is needed.
5. Does the transponder key require a battery to begin the car?
In a lot of traditional "turn-key" ignitions, no. The chip is passive and powered by the ignition coil. However, in "push-to-start" lorries, the key usually needs a battery to broadcast its existence to the car's interior antennas.
